Jerez day one - Raikkonen leads the way for Lotus |
2012-02-08 01:10:00 |
| He may have been away from the sport for the last two seasons but that didn't stop 2007 world champion Kimi Raikkonen from topping the timesheets, as this year's opening test got underway in Jerez on Tuesday. Raikkonen clocked a best time of 1m 19.670s at the Spanish circuit in the new Lotus E20.
Paul di Resta was second in Force India's 2012 car, the VJM05, ahead of Nico Rosberg, who was third in the 2011-spec Mercedes. Rosberg's team mate Michael Schumacher was also in action in the MGP W02 during the day and took the sixth slot. The team focused on testing Pirelli's 2012 tyres.

Rosberg extends contract with Mercedes |
2011-11-10 18:15:00 |
| Mercedes announced on Thursday that Nico Rosberg has signed a new multi-year contract extension which will include 2013 and beyond. It means the German team will enjoy stability in its driver line-up for a third consecutive season as Rosberg's team mate Michael Schumacher will also be driving next season.
"I am very excited to have extended my contract with the team, said the 26 year-old. To win in a Silver Arrow will be one of the highlights of my life so far, and I greatly enjoy helping to lead our team in our quest to become the best in Formula One.

Petrov signs up for 2011 Race of Champions |
2011-11-02 20:55:00 |
| Renault driver Vitaly Petrov is set to compete at this year's Race of Champions (ROC) event, which will take place in the German city of Dusseldorf next month. The ROC is an annual end-of-season competition which brings together the world's greatest drivers from various motorsport disciplines and pitches them head-to-head in identical machinery.
Russian Petrov will be the first driver from Eastern Europe to compete at the event and will join three Formula One champions - Jenson Button, Michael Schumacher and Sebastian Vettel - and Renault reserve Romain Grosjean at the event.

Karthikeyan penalised for impeding Schumacher |
2011-10-29 20:31:00 |
| HRT's Narain Karthikeyan has been handed a five-place grid penalty by the Indian stewards for impeding Mercedes' Michael Schumacher during Saturday's qualifying session for the New Delhi race.
After reviewing the evidence, the stewards decided Karthikeyan had blocked Schumacher during Q1. Despite the incident, the German managed to make it through to Q2 and eventually qualified in 12th. Karthikeyan, meanwhile, qualified in 21st.

Petrov handed five-place grid penalty for India |
2011-10-16 18:45:00 |
| Renault's Vitaly Petrov has been punished by the Korean stewards for his collision with the Mercedes of Michael Schumacher during the Yeongam race on Sunday. Petrov receives a reprimand and a five-place grid penalty for the next round in India.
After investigating, the stewards decided the Russian driver was at fault for the accident, which occurred on the approach to Turn Three on Lap 17. Although Petrov was able to make it back to the pits he subsequently retired. The damage to the rear of Schumacher's Mercedes was similarly terminal.

20 years on - Schumacher's spectacular Spa debut |
2011-08-24 05:01:00 |
| Hard to believe as it is, this weekend's Belgian race marks the 20th anniversary of the start of the most successful career in Formula One history. On August 25, 1991, Michael Schumacher made his Formula One race debut at the wheel of a Jordan 191. It was short-lived - less than a lap - but instantly hinted at what the future might hold. Schumacher: You will see me in 2012 |
2011-08-16 18:56:00 |
| Mercedes' Michael Schumacher has rebuffed rumours that he is set to retire (again) at the end of the 2011 season. It follows recent speculation that the seven-time champion could be replaced for 2012 in light of his disappointing form since joining the German team last year.
Schumacher was overshadowed by younger team mate Nico Rosberg in 2010, and although he has closed the gap this season, Rosberg has still scored 50 percent more points thus far in 2011. Nevertheless, the 42-year-old insists he will be fulfilling his Mercedes contract next year
